for $1,350,000 with 1 bedroom and 2 full baths. This 1,130 square foot home was built in 1905.
A true sanctuary іn the hеart οf Chelѕеа, 107 West 25th Street, ⵌ5Β οffеrs а rare balance of tranquility and urban energy, paired with the kind of scale and openness loft lovers seek. This expansive approximately 1,130-square-foot authentic co-op loft is currently configured as a one bedroom with a separate home office, complemented by two beautifully appointed bathrooms, one complete with a stackable Washer/Dryer. The immaculately designed kitchen is outfitted with a Jenn-Air refrigerator and Bosch stainless steel appliances, including a built-in microwave, dishwasher, and wine fridge, and is complemented by a counter height breakfast bar. Nearly 11-foot ceilings, gallery lighting, and museum-like wall space elevate the residence’s loft sensibility, creating an effortless backdrop for art, entertaining, and modern living. Building amenities include a spectacular roof deck, bike room, rentable storage units, keyed elevator access, and a video intercom system—offering thoughtful conveniences that enhance everyday living. Perfectly situated less than a block from Fairway and Whole Foods, and just two blocks from Madison Square Park, this home provides effortless access to Chelsea’s best dining, shopping, and cultural destinations. Proximity to the 1, F, M, N, R, and W trains ensures seamless connectivity to the rest of New York City. Chelsea is a neighborhood where luxury meets creativity—a lively blend of world-class art galleries, landmark architecture, and a dynamic entertainment scene. Here, uptown sophistication meets downtown edge, creating a lifestyle that’s as inspiring as it is convenient. *Please note there is an assessment of $272.33 in place for current lobby renovation.
